We will follow the textbook ` Multivariable Calculus' by Ron Larson, Bruce Edwards (10th edition), chapter 11-15.
vector calculus including the theorems of Green, Gauss, and Stokes. Applications to economics, engineering, and all sciences,
with emphasis on numerical and graphical solutions; use of graphing calculators or computers. May not be taken for credit
in addition to AMS 261 or MAT 205.
Prerequisite: C or higher in MAT 127 or 132 or 142 or AMS 161 or level 9 on the mathematics placement examination
